León, Mexico, is known for its rich history and vibrant culture, making it an interesting destination for visitors. One of the key attractions is the historic center, where you can explore beautiful colonial architecture, including the Basilica Cathedral, which features stunning stained glass and intricate design. Nearby, the Plaza Principal offers a lively atmosphere with local vendors and a chance to experience everyday life in the city.
For those interested in history, the Museo de Arte e Historia de Guanajuato provides a comprehensive overview of the region's past and showcases diverse art collections. Another important site is the Teatro Manuel Doblado, an elegant theater that hosts various performances and cultural events throughout the year.
León is also famous for its leather industry, so visiting the local tanneries can provide insight into traditional craftsmanship. The Mercado Aldama is an excellent place to shop for leather goods, where you can find everything from shoes to bags.
Food lovers will appreciate the local cuisine, which includes traditional dishes like birria and tacos al pastor. Exploring local markets, such as the Mercado de la Zona Piel, allows you to sample authentic flavors and experience the culinary culture firsthand.
For outdoor enthusiasts, the Parque Metropolitano offers green spaces for walking, jogging, or simply enjoying nature. The park is a good spot to relax and unwind away from the urban hustle.
Finally, if you're in León during the Feria de León, you can experience the vibrant atmosphere of this annual fair, which features rides, games, concerts, and a showcase of local culture. This event reflects the city's spirit and is an exciting time to visit.
